About Arno Werners

Arno Werners is a scholar working on Parasitology, Ecology, Evolution, Behavior and Systematics, Immunology, Infectious Diseases and Molecular Biology, having authored 18 papers that have together received 276 indexed citations. Recurring topics across this work include Vector-borne infectious diseases (7 papers), Vector-Borne Animal Diseases (5 papers), Immune Response and Inflammation (5 papers), Viral Infections and Vectors (3 papers), Ion Transport and Channel Regulation (2 papers), Drug Transport and Resistance Mechanisms (2 papers), Veterinary Practice and Education Studies (2 papers) and Problem and Project Based Learning (2 papers). The work is most often cited by research in Equine (58 citations), Parasitology (89 citations), Small Animals (29 citations), Immunology (67 citations) and Infectious Diseases (51 citations). Arno Werners has collaborated with scholars based in Grenada, Netherlands and United Kingdom. Frequent co-authors include Johanna Fink‐Gremmels, Sarah Bull, Clare Bryant, Catherine M. Butler, Tom A. E. Stout, D.J. Houwers, M M Sloet van Oldruitenborgh-Oosterbaan, J.H. van der Kolk, M. Nielen and S Mauss. Their work appears in journals such as Journal of Veterinary Pharmacology and Therapeutics, Veterinary Immunology and Immunopathology, Equine Veterinary Journal, Journal of Pharmacology and Experimental Therapeutics and Innate Immunity.
